Hi Darrow,

Welcome to the on-call rotation. Quick heads-up before the weekly sync: per-tenant rate quotas on Quillstream are enforced at the gateway, and overrides expire after 48 hours, so don't hand them out casually. Quota bump requests need a ticket and a reviewer. The current limits and override procedure are documented here.

wiki page, tahaf-tajog: https://jira.ordindyn.corp/pipeline

Finance Review Summary — Training Budget

The board reviewed next year's training budget for Tarnwell Logistics. Proposed allocation rises 9%, driven by the Ridgeline certification program and new compliance modules. Finance considers the increase sustainable given current margins. Approval is recommended at the next sitting. A confidential planning note follows for board members only.

board note of tadup-tajog: Headcount on the Oliiel team goes from 31 to 88 by the end of February. Gross margin on Oliiel came in at 62 percent against a plan of 29 percent.

Ticket: Drift found on Quietbell, the on-call alert deduplicator. The dedup window and grouping keys running in production differ from what's in the release manifest — likely a hotfix applied during the Varnholt outage that never landed in the repo. Until reconciled, duplicate pages may slip through for multi-region alerts. Hold the next release train until values match. Current declared configuration follows.

deployment values, bahip-bawip:
ulawyn:
  log_level: warn
  metrics_host: metrics.ulawyn.lumicsys.internal
  pool_size: 16

Subject: Partner SFTP drop — new owner

Hi,

As you review the pending changes to the Harborline ingest scripts, note that ownership of the partner SFTP drop is changing at the end of the month. This includes key rotation, the nightly pull job, and the quarantine folder for malformed files. Review comments on the retry logic should still go through the normal PR flow, but questions about drop-folder conventions or partner onboarding now go to the new owner. The incoming owner is listed below.

signatory, tagaf-bahaf: Praael Fenmir Rusok